Automator + iCal + Transmit = score!
Scheduled tasks on a PC are easy. With a Mac it’s easy and fun! I needed to make daily backups for a client to our local server. Leopard comes with Automator, a cool app to , you’ve guessed it, automate tasks. Since I’m using Transmit as my dedicated ftp client it gets only better!
Automator has Transmit defaults build in. As stated on Transmits website it’s not in the library anymore but you can find it under the ‘Internet’ submenu of your library. Another place to look is ‘Most Relevant’ and ‘Most Used’.
setting up an workflow in Automator is pretty intuitive and you should be able to crank out a workflow within minutes. Now comes the sweet part. Rather then saving it as a workflow you can save your task as an application. To set up a scheduled task open iCal and create a new event. In the ‘alarm’ section select ‘open file’ and pick your newly created application. You can manually set the time when to launch this, in my case 3X a week at midnight.
When waking up my files are downloaded to the folder I told it to, zipped up and renamed with a date stamp. Life is sweet…